Build
Users can create builds in Configuration, which will then appear on the drop-down list on the execution screen. The functionality is helpful to users as it saves users' time and effort required in typing the build name repeatedly. Also, typing the same build name repeatedly may also induce typo errors.
Note
Required Permissions:
Jira Permissions: Browse Project permissions are required.
QMetry Permissions: If enabled, then the following permissions are required.
Configuration View
Configuration Modify
Create a Build
You must have the Configuration Modify access to the project for creating Builds.
Perform the following steps to create builds:
Go to the QMetry menu and select Configuration.
Under Test Execution, select Build.
Enter a Build name and its Description. Then click Add.
Add Build Values Inline
The Build field values can be added inline in the test asset detail page. For example, a Build value "4.0.6" is added in the test case detail page.
In the Build field, type the field value.
An option to create the value is prompted. Click it or press ENTER.

Edit a Build
You must have the Configuration Modify access to the project to edit a created build.
Perform the following steps to edit a build:
Click the build, and a text box appears to enter the new build name.
After typing the new name, click the tick mark symbol. Also, editing the description field can be done on similar lines.
Copy Build to Other QMetry Projects
You can copy Builds from one project to other project, which saves time in creating duplicates for different projects. The functionality allows users to use similar items in different QMetry projects without having to add these items individually.
Select the items that you want to copy to other QMetry Projects and click Copy.

Select the project where you want to copy the selected items. You can select multiple QMetry Projects (a maximum of five projects) at a time to copy an item.

Duplicate entities will be ignored while copying.
Delete a Build
You can also delete a build that is no longer required. Once a build is deleted, all its associations will be removed.
Permission required: You must have the Configuration Modify permission to the project to delete a build that is no longer in use.
Perform the following steps to delete a build:
Go to the QMetry menu and select Configuration.
Under Test Execution, select Build. The build's list is displayed on the screen.
Click the Delete icon of the build that you want to delete.
If a build is used in a test case execution, it cannot be deleted. An error will be displayed for the same.
Search for a Build
The Searching feature helps you locate the required build easily, even if it is a long list of builds on the screen. You can also search for a build before creating a new one to avoid duplication.
Perform the following steps to search for a build:
Navigate to QMetry, select the Configuration menu, and select your project.
Click Build under Test Execution.
Click the search icon to see the text box. Type the keyword in the text box and press ENTER on the keyboard.
